Duke Cooper Flagg Player Props vs. Baylor
Cooper Flagg is the heartbeat of this Duke team, and his performance against Baylor could be the difference-maker. Let’s dive deeper into his player props. At BetMGM Sportsbook, Flagg’s over/under for points is set at 18.5, with rebounds at 7.5, and assists at 4.5. These numbers tell a story—they tell us that Flagg is not just a scorer but a complete player.
